Collection Handler, William B. Meyer, Inc., Boston, MA

Wage/​Salary: $15. hour Job Description: Identify, scan, pack and shift library collections.Hours: Monday – Friday; 8 am to 4:40 pmFull time, temporary position beginning December 18, 2017 through approximatley March 27, 2018. Must read, write and speak English fluently. Must be reliable. Application Instructions: Please visit http://www.meyerlibrary.com/library-job-opportunities/ and upload your resume.

Call for Participation, Digital Methods Winter School 2018, University of Amsterdam, the Netherlands

The Digital Methods Initiative (DMI) will host its 10th annual DigitalMethods Winter School from January 8-12, 2018 at the University ofAmsterdam, the Netherlands. This year’s theme is: “The Social Lives of Digital Methods: Encounters,Experiments, Interventions”. The deadline for application is December 7,2017.
